Fratelli Cosulich Group: Global Maritime Services & Ship Management
Fratelli Cosulich Group is a well-established Italian maritime company founded in 1857, with a global presence across 28 countries. They offer a wide range of services including ship management, crew management, and operate a diverse fleet.
Key Facts
- Fratelli Cosulich Group provides extensive maritime services including Liner Agency, Tramp Agency, and Manning and Training.
- The company is involved in Shipowning and Marine Energy, with a focus on innovative vessel development.
- Their fleet includes Container Ships, Offshore Vessels, Passenger Ships, and Gas Tankers.
- Fratelli Cosulich Group operates a modern bunker fleet, with new generation methanol-ready IMO II bunker tankers.
- They offer comprehensive crew management services, including meticulous selection and training programs, backed by ISO accreditation.
- The group's business units extend to Freight Forwarding, Warehousing, Trucking, and Yachting Agency services.
- With 167 years of experience, Fratelli Cosulich Group is committed to global excellence and innovation in shipping and logistics.
- The company has a significant global footprint, with 15 Business Units and operations in 28 countries.
- Fratelli Cosulich Group is actively involved in the marine energy sector, expanding its fleet with advanced bunker vessels.
- Career opportunities within Fratelli Cosulich Group span various maritime and business functions.
- The company emphasizes its identity, values, and commitment to ESG principles.
- Fratelli Cosulich Group has a history rooted in the Adriatic, founded by the Cosulich brothers.

What STCW certificates and endorsements are required for Deck Officers and Marine Engineers on Fratelli Cosulich Group's diverse fleet?
To join Fratelli Cosulich Group's fleet, which includes Container Ships, Offshore Vessels, Passenger Ships, Gas Tankers, and Tankers, all seafarers must hold valid STCW 2010 Basic Safety Training (BST/STCW A-VI/1), Certificate of Competency (COC) appropriate to their rank and vessel type, and a national flag state endorsement. For specific vessel types, additional certifications are crucial; for example, Gas Tanker and Tanker operations require relevant Tanker Endorsements (STCW A-V/1), while Offshore Vessels often demand Dynamic Positioning (DP) certification for DPOs. Deck officers will need Proficiency in Survival Craft and Rescue Boats (PSC/STCW A-VI/2) and Advanced Fire Fighting (AFF/STCW A-VI/3), alongside Vessel Personnel with Designated Security Duties (VPDSD). Marine engineers require similar safety certifications tailored to the engine department, such as Rating Forming Part of an Engineering Watch (RFPEW) for ratings.

Beyond general STCW, what specific endorsements like Dynamic Positioning (DP) or Tanker Endorsements are critical for Fratelli Cosulich Group's specialized fleet?
Given Fratelli Cosulich Group's operation of specialized vessels like Offshore Vessels, Gas Tankers, and Tankers, specific endorsements beyond generic STCW are indeed critical. For those seeking offshore jobs on their Offshore Vessels, Dynamic Positioning (DP) Basic, Advanced, or Unlimited certification is often a mandatory requirement for DPOs and potentially other bridge officers. Seafarers applying for Gas Tanker or Tanker crew jobs must possess the appropriate STCW A-V/1 Tanker Endorsements (Oil, Chemical, or Liquefied Gas) relevant to the cargo being carried.
